I would seriously buy a new one. I'm in the market but don't need or want to pay for a full size and don't like the Colorado or Taco. This thing would decimate the sales for the Colorado save for the diehards. The Tacoma will live forever regardless.
Also, I think Ford has always likes shitting on parades. In the last 6 months they stole Acuras Thunder about the NSX with the surprise GT release and somehow the Focus RS got more attention and excitement than Ferrari's 488. A few years back I remember them releasing the power figures for the Mustang GT 500 hours after Chevy announced/debuted the ZL1, the Ford of course being more powerful. And then there's the whole history of the Ford GT and Ferrari. They need to change their slogan to "Ford-Built for the troll in us all" or something if that nature.
